In scientific classification, organisms are categorized using a binomial naming system, which includes the genus name followed by the species name. This system is known as binomial nomenclature and was developed by Carl Linnaeus.
For example:
- The scientific name for humans is *Homo sapiens*, where *Homo* is the genus and *sapiens* is the species.
- The scientific name for the domestic cat is *Felis catus*, where *Felis* is the genus and *catus* is the species.
In this system, the genus name is always capitalized, while the species name is not. Both names are typically italicized or underlined.
